FOR AN ACT ENTITLED, An Act to
require the Department of Revenue and Regulation to
maintain an internet site that allows the public to search for certain property assessment and
taxation information.
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F SOUTH DAKOTA:
Section 1. That chapter 10-6 be amended by adding thereto a NEW SECTION to read as follows:

The treasurer of each county shall maintain a list of the true and full value, taxable value,
and taxes payable for each parcel of property in the county by the legal description and the
mailing address of the property. Beginning on July 1, 2009, the county treasurer shall provide
an updated list of this information to the Department of Revenue and Regulation by July first
each year. The Department of Revenue and Regulation shall post and maintain an internet site
that provides access to the public regarding this property assessment and taxation information.
The public shall be able to search this internet site based either on the legal description or the
mailing address of the property. The internet site address shall be prominently displayed on the notice of assessment that is mailed to each property owner pursuant to § 10-6-50.
